Description
English: The wet hood ornament on a 1967 Marlin by American Motors (AMC), a full-sized, two-door pillarless fastback personal luxury car. Finished in "Sungold metallic" (paint code P-37) with optional two-tone (white roof and lower bodysides). Photographs taken at the AMCRC car show held in Somerset, New Jersey, USA, August 8 and 9, 2003.
